You must determine how much you are going to price your merchandise for. If you plan to manufacture the items that you sell, you'll first need to research and compute what your cost will be to produce them. A general rule of thumb is to double the price it costs to produce. This is what you should charge when others buy wholesale. The retail price should be set at three times the cost. A checking account designed for businesses helps you keep track of your business's financial activity separately from your personal finances. Funnel all your business transactions through this account. It's the best and most accurate way to keep track of your business's activity. You should set up a separate business credit card account as well, using it for things like ordering supplies and paying contractors. Make sure to maintain full, accurate financial books. If an IRS or local audit occurs, you will have to provide proof of income and expenditures. Having accurate records to refer to also aids in tracking the progress of your business on a monthly basis. Safety is supremely important in your workplace. You should definitely have a fire extinguisher and active smoke detectors. You should also have a computer set-up that properly suits you. Installing fire safety items can help lower insurance premiums, and a safe, ergonomic computer desk and accessories reduce the risk of carpal tunnel injuries.
